首页
学习
活动
专区
工具
TVP
发布
您找到你想要的搜索结果了吗?
是的
没有找到

Checked Exception 和 Unchecked Exception 有什么区别?

Checked Exception 强制开发者在编码过程中对可能发生的异常进行处理,以避免程序在运行时出现未捕获的异常导致程序崩溃。这样可以增加代码的健壮性,并且使得代码更易于理解和维护。...Unchecked Exception 则用于表示程序中的逻辑错误或其他无法预料的异常情况。由于这些异常通常是由程序员的错误造成的,因此不需要强制开发者在编码过程中处理它们。...Checked Exception 和 Unchecked Exception 的优点 Checked Exception 的优点: 强制开发者在编码过程中处理可能发生的异常,提高了代码的健壮性...Checked Exception 和 Unchecked Exception 的缺点 Checked Exception 的缺点: 强制开发者在编码过程中处理异常,增加了代码的复杂性。...Checked Exception 强制开发者在编码过程中处理可能发生的异常,而 Unchecked Exception 用于表示程序中的逻辑错误或其他无法预料的异常情况。

14740
领券